Comprehending SCHD
Before delving into the annual dividend calculation, let's briefly discuss what SCHD is. The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F is crafted to track the performance of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index. It consists mostly of high dividend yielding U.S. stocks that have a record of regularly paying dividends. SCHD intends to offer a high level of income while likewise using chances for capital gratitude.

Approximating your annual dividends from SCHD includes inputting a few variables into a dividend calculator. The primary variables typically include:
Number of shares owned: The total SCHD shares you own.Current dividend per share: The latest stated dividend.Dividend frequency: Typically, dividends for SCHD are paid quarterly.Formula for Annual Dividend Calculation
The formula to calculate your annual dividends is relatively simple:

[\ text Annual Dividends = \ text Number of Shares Owned \ times \ text Dividends per Share \ times \ text Dividend Frequency]Example Calculation
Let's analyze the annual dividends utilizing an example. Suppose an investor owns 100 shares of SCHD and the most recent dividend per share is ₤ 1.25. The dividend is dispersed quarterly (4 times a year).
ParameterValueVariety Of Shares Owned100Existing Dividend per Share₤ 1.25Dividend Frequency (per year)4
Utilizing our formula, we can calculate:

[\ text Annual Dividends = 100 \ times 1.25 \ times 4 = 500]
In this case, the investor would receive ₤ 500 in annual dividends from owning 100 shares of SCHD.
The Importance of Reinvesting Dividends
While getting dividend payments is worthwhile, consider reinvesting them through a Dividend Reinvestment Plan (DRIP). This strategy permits financiers to purchase extra shares of SCHD using the dividends got, possibly compounding their returns with time.
